A ring-necked beauty


We decided to do a quick drive through the strip pits tonight...the first thing we saw was a ring-necked pheasant. Not this one. The first one flew off and landed in weeds, etc. that were tall enough for him to hide in.
But we spotted this fellow on a bit farther and he started to run when I stepped out of the car...the bottom picture is actually one of the first taken. Anyway, when he started to run, I got back in the Rav4 and he only ran a few feet and went back to eating.

I would have liked to get closer but could not unless I wanted to be wet up to my ankles...plus it is posted with keep out signs every where you look. So from the roadside is about the only way I ever take a photo out there. I just really feel like I have to respect people's rights...
